#c4eff9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4eff9 is composed of 76.9% red, 93.7%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.3% cyan, 4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 191.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 87.3%. #c4eff9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#89dff3.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

Shades and Tints of #c4eff9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0c is the darkest color, while #f9f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4eff9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dddfe0 is the less saturated color, while #bff2fe is the most saturated one.
